A Love Story That Started with “You Two Look Alike”
Among Korea’s celebrity couples, Son Ye-jin and Hyun Bin are royalty. Their on-screen chemistry and real-life romance have captured hearts worldwide. But surprisingly, their story began with something simple—people saying they looked alike.
"I never thought I looked like him," Son Ye-jin said with a smile, "but people kept saying it. So I looked at him more closely and began to wonder—do we really feel the same way about each other?"

Breaking Stereotypes: Not Every Co-Star Becomes a Partner
Son Ye-jin openly admitted she once disliked the idea of co-stars dating. Having witnessed countless on-set romances fade, she remained detached from the trend.
Her love for Hyun Bin wasn't born of convenience or proximity. It grew from mutual respect and deep emotional connection—a relationship nurtured by time, not driven by spotlight.
“I didn’t rush,” she said. “I made the decision knowing exactly who I was.”

Motherhood: The Role With No Script
Following her wedding and the birth of her son, Son Ye-jin stepped away from the public eye. But far from disappearing, she was taking on the most immersive role of her life—being a mother.
“Just like when I first started acting, I had to figure things out on my own,” she said. “But becoming a mom brought me more happiness than I ever imagined.”
